Output 3fe3050f6961440b215bc32ad98883c3e0bd563d85bf23df83cd04b85ac7ec06:0

value
575695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a904838968897d3111e99d81d4f548b8582fcf18 OP_EQUAL
address
3H6hXb5vzjqUALxnjpmSCirUgKdiYE1R2x
transaction
3fe3050f6961440b215bc32ad98883c3e0bd563d85bf23df83cd04b85ac7ec06
spent
true